Automotive applications account for a significant portion of demand. Crosslinking agents enhance polymer components such as tires, seals, gaskets, and under-the-hood parts, providing thermal stability, chemical resistance, and improved mechanical performance. As vehicle production increases globally and electric vehicle adoption rises, the demand for advanced polymers incorporating crosslinking agents is expected to grow.
Construction and building materials also contribute substantially. Crosslinked polymers are used in coatings, adhesives, sealants, and insulation materials. These products require durability, resistance to weathering, and long-term performance, which crosslinking agents enable. The need for sustainable and energy-efficient materials further accelerates market adoption.
In electronics, crosslinking agents improve the thermal and mechanical stability of plastics used in semiconductors, wiring, and electronic housings. Their ability to enhance polymer properties ensures reliable performance in increasingly complex and miniaturized electronic devices.
The pharmaceutical and biomedical sectors are adopting crosslinking agents for hydrogels, drug delivery systems, and biocompatible polymer scaffolds. These agents enable precise structural control, improved functionality, and enhanced product efficacy, addressing critical healthcare needs.
Sustainability and regulatory compliance are shaping product development. Eco-friendly crosslinking agents with low VOC emissions and environmentally safe production processes are increasingly favored. Manufacturers focusing on green chemistry and sustainable innovations can capture emerging market opportunities while complying with stringent environmental standards.
Regionally, North America and Europe dominate due to established chemical industries, technological expertise, and regulatory compliance. Asia-Pacific shows strong growth potential due to rapid industrialization, urbanization, and rising demand in automotive, electronics, and construction sectors. Latin America and the Middle East are gradually expanding market adoption, supported by growing industrial infrastructure.
